if your camping at goodwood were camping at lakeside

llandow is at llandow camp site next the circuit

llys y fran is on site in the field

curborough is on circuit

 

Castle Coombe is on circuit

harewood is at the top of the hill

anglsey is in the paddock

 

 

not sure of the rest

However, although the accommodation listed under L7 recommendations is very nice, as a lot of you will know, accommodation down here at the seaside is very expensive - if you are looking for clean and tidy but not glam try:

Goodwood Park@ Westhampnet

Premier Inn@ Shripney (Bognor Regis)

Comfort Inn @Arundel

Listed in order of proximity to track. You can leave your 7 and trailer at the circuit the night before so there are no worries about car park car theft.
